Large parts of California will not get the Raiders and Texans NFL Week 7 game on TV

Abbie Parr/AP

Many parts of California will not get to see the Raiders take on the Texans from Allegiant Stadium on Sunday.

Kickoff is 1:05 p.m. PDT and it will be shown on CBS. Calling the game will be Greg Gumbel (play-by-play) and Adam Archuleta (analyst).

The Raiders (1-4) and Texans (1-3-1) are coming off a bye.

The Bay Area, Los Angeles and San Diego will not get the game. Instead, they will be getting the Dallas and Detroit game that will start at 10 a.m.

It’s a single game for CBS.

506 Sports listed which regions will get the Raiders and Texans game. Of course, it’s subject to change.

California: Fresno (KGPE 47), Sacramento (KOVR 13)

Others: Las Vegas (KLAS 8), Reno (KTVN 2), Houston (KHOU 11)

The game can also be seen on NFL+ and Paramount+.
